The Reign of Hammurabi (4h 24min, jan 11, 1792 y BC – 10h 9min, mar 12, 1750 y BC)
Description:
During the rule of Hammurabi, a Babylonian king, the first written code of laws was established. For the first time, laws were written down for the people to see. Hammurabi enforced his code throughout his rule. This event influences our principles of law and order today.
